Ingredients
-
1 lb ground beef (or ground turkey)
-
1 onion, diced
-
3 garlic cloves, minced
-
3 carrots, sliced
-
2 celery stalks, chopped
-
1 green bell pepper, chopped
-
1 cup frozen peas
-
1 (14 oz) can diced tomatoes
-
6 cups beef broth
-
1 tsp Italian seasoning
-
1 tsp paprika
-
Salt & pepper, to taste
-
2 cups uncooked elbow macaroni
-
Fresh parsley, for garnish
Instructions
-
In a large pot, brown the ground beef over medium heat. Drain excess fat if needed.
-
Add onion, garlic, carrots, celery, and bell pepper. Cook 5 minutes until softened.
-
Stir in diced tomatoes, broth, Italian seasoning, paprika, salt, and pepper. Bring to a boil.
-
Add macaroni and simmer 12–15 minutes, until pasta is tender.
-
Stir in frozen peas during the last 5 minutes of cooking.
-
Garnish with fresh parsley and serve hot.

Notes
Swap beef for ground turkey or chicken for a lighter option.
Use gluten-free pasta if needed.
Add red pepper flakes for a little kick.
